Pullman Visitor Center

11141 S. Cottage Grove Ave., Chicago, IL 60628

History Museums

Pullman is a unique community on Chicago's far, south side that blends the history from many different disciplines in a fascinating touring experience. Visiting this area today brings you into that history and also into a new sense of place, seeing the community as it is today. Stop here for exhibits and tours.
